Getting hooked on Baking

I baked again today. Well it's my baby cousin's birthday so I decided to bake her something... As if I'm doing the batter by scratch. I keep on using Betty Crocker Super Moist cake mix ( my moms sends us boxes of those). This time instead of using the Devil's cake mix, I used this one...



Ingredients:

1. (1) pack Betty Crocker Super Moist Cake Mix - White

2. 1 1/4 cup water

3. 1/2 cup oil

4. 3 eggs



Steps:

1. Pre- heat oven at 325 degress for non stick pan

 

 

 

2. Combine all ingredients in a bowl



 

 

 

 

 

 

3. Using a mixer, mix all the ingredients until there are no more lumps or when the batter is throughly mixed.



 

 

 

 

 

 

It should look something like this...



 

 

 

 

 

 

4. Once it's done, transfer the mixture into a baking pan. In my case I used Baker's Secret Flexible Silicon Bakeware 9- inch round cake pan. It's more convenient for me since it's "rubbery".



 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

I then sprayed the insides of the cake pan with Pam Vegetable Oil spray to prevent the cake mix from sticking. Although the pan is already a non-stick pan, I still sprayed it just in case.

5. Since the oven has already been preheated, place the cake pan and let it bake.

I don't usually follow the exact baking time. I really on the "toothpick test". So when nothing or just a few crumbs stick to the toothpick, it means the cake's ready to go.
